Research on Two-Position North-Seeking Method Based on the Single Axis FOG

Abstract:

The basic working principle and the two-position north-seeking method based on single-axis FOG(fiber optic gyroscope) is researched in this paper. Improved north-seeking method was proposed to solve the problem in the two-position FOG north-seeking scheme. To Sample in three positions of 0º, 90ºand 180ºseparately and obtain the measurement values of angular rate in these three positions. Then according to the measurement values of angular rate in the first and the third positions to calculate the north-seeking angle, and using the positive and negative pulse outputs of the FOG in the second position to obtain the specific direction information of carrier. So that, accomplish the north-seeking in the range of 0~360° for single-axis FOG. The experiment results showed that the accuracy of the improved two-position north-seeking program based on single-axis FOG is 0.101 (1σ) within 4 minutes.
